Output f21b5a2e2e53d63ba7f980796a2989b00356711a46a723212522bf458c983c09: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e50ad735109048acc16593d199faa5c5b6aa8e OP_EQUAL
address
3Giu89NZbrxocd62dGx7nruCrAQynpF3va
transaction
f21b5a2e2e53d63ba7f980796a2989b00356711a46a723212522bf458c983c09